Professional Documents
Culture Documents
RUN
Logika :
01 AWAL : adalah judul dari permulaan program, dengan menyertakan syarat-syarat sebagai berikut, Nama yang akan tercetak maksimal adalah terjadi 10 nama. 77 I PIC 9(2). dan 77 N PIC 9(2). : 77 berati suatu variabel yang berdiri sendiri., variabel tersebut pada program ini adalah I dan N. PIC 9(2) artinya bahwa suatu deklarasi numerik yang akan menampilkan sebanyak 2 digita angka. PROCEDURE DIVISION : penggambaran prosedur yang akan digunakan untuk menyelesaikan permasalah program tersebut yang terdiri dari MULAI, ULANG, TAMPIL dan AKHIR. MULAI : Program ini, dimulai dengan menampilkan kalimat perintah untuk menginput jumlah nama. lalu, Nama, yaitu N diterima. PERFORM (memanggil) prosedur HASIL. HASIL : Pada bagian ini, akan ditampilkan kalimat perintah untuk menginput nama-nama yang akan ditampilhan. lalu nama-nama tersebut disimpan. ULANG : Memberikan jarak untuk nama selanjutnya yang akan diinput, dengan menampilkan kembali perintah untuk menginput nama. TAMPIL : Menampilkan nama-nama yang sudah diinput.
VIVI ARYANTI, UNIVERSITAS GUNADARMA-SISTEM INFORMASI FAKULTAS ILMU KOMPUTER DAN TEKNOLOGI INFORMATIKA
AKHIR : Mengakhiri program tersebut, dengan code STOP RUN. Untuk membuat tabel nilai pada COBOL, kitaakukan pengkodingan seperti ini :
** Penjelasan logika, hampir sama. 77 N berarti variabel yang berdiri sendiri, variabel disini adalah N. PIC 99 merupakan deklarasi numerik yang menampilkan 2 digit angka. 01 TABEL-NILAI-SISWA & 01 HAPUS-LAYAR adalah judul dari suatu perintah yang terdapat di bawahnya. PROCEDURE DIVISION : penggambaran prosedur yang akan digunakan untuk menyelesaikan permasalah program tersebut yang terdiri dari PROGRAM UTAMA, PPEMASUKAN NILAI SISWA dan TAMPILAN NILAI SISWA. :
VIVI ARYANTI, UNIVERSITAS GUNADARMA-SISTEM INFORMASI FAKULTAS ILMU KOMPUTER DAN TEKNOLOGI INFORMATIKA